Vietnam 's northern Thai Nguyen to turn it into an eco-industrial city

Thai Nguyen (VNA) - Three major corporations from China are planning to pour around 2 billion USD into Vietnam 's northern Thai Nguyen to turn it into an eco-industrial city, said a local official.

Thai Nguyen's Planning and Investment Department Director Nguyen Duc Minh said local authorities recently signed a memorandum of understanding on the project with representatives of China 's Shan Shan, Sun Khun and Honghuigroups.

The Chinese investors pledged to submit the project feasibility study to theprovince for consideration by October at the earliest.

The planned eco-industrial city is expected to cover 1,500-2,000 ha. It will feature a state-of-the-art manufacturing area, a scientific-technological area, a hi-tech experimental research area, a physical architectural area, atraditional industrial park, a trading and entertainment centre, and villas.

According to the department, Thai Nguyen currently houses 13 Chinese-invested projects with a combined registered capital of 18 million USD. Of these, 10 projects have been put into operation and the others arewaiting for site clearance.

The projects, focusing on mineral processing, fertiliser and drinks production, and entertainment services, have helped to promote the local socio-economic development, create jobs and encourage the inflow of foreign investment into the province.-Enditem
